Air Fryer Garlic Bread

The best air fryer garlic bread you could whip up quickly, perfect as a side or stand-alone dish for any meal.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 7 minutes
Total Time 17 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Appetizer, Side Dish
Cuisine: American, Italian
Calories: 200

Ingredients
  

For the Garlic Butter Spread
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ened You can substitute with salted butter.
  • 4-5 cloves garlic, minced Adjust the amount according to preference.
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ped Dried parsley can be used as a substitute.
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t Adjust to taste.
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per Add according to taste.
For the Bread
  • 1 French baguette French baguette (or any bread of your choice) Can use sourdough, Italian, or gluten-free bread.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. In a mixing bowl, combine the softened butter, minced garlic, parsley, salt, and pepper. Mix until well-combined.
  2. Slice the baguette in half lengthwise or into quarters while keeping pieces mostly attached.
  3. Generously smear the garlic butter mixture onto the cut sides of the bread.
Cooking
  1. Preheat your air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Place the bread (cut sides up) in the fryer basket and cook for about 5-7 minutes until golden brown.
Serving
  1. Remove from the basket, let cool for a moment then slice and serve.

Notes

For extra crunch, sprinkle grated Parmesan cheese over the garlic butter before air frying.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at in air fryer for crispiness.
